Output 84b39b7e43635d24aa3ae190b68a1f5bafd3f02cdc5f99b4cc874f06edd1ad3d:0

value
694317
script pubkey
OP_0 OP_PUSHBYTES_20 ddaa160a3ad4cc52907418129df5d622f4f5417a
address
bc1qmk4pvz366nx99yr5rqffmawkyt602st6jxyh94
transaction
84b39b7e43635d24aa3ae190b68a1f5bafd3f02cdc5f99b4cc874f06edd1ad3d